Summary of The Lady and the Bandit (1951)

The Lady and the Bandit is a swashbuckling adventure film set in 18th-century England that brings to life the legendary tales of the infamous highwayman, Dick Turpin. Directed by the skilled veteran, Leslie Arliss, this colorful romp combines romance, intrigue, and thrilling escapades across the English countryside.

Plot Overview

The narrative focuses on the charismatic Dick Turpin, portrayed by Louis Hayward. Renowned for his daring exploits and crafty evasion of authorities, Turpin’s life takes a dramatic turn when he encounters the beautiful and spirited Lady Bess, played by Patricia Medina. Their meeting ignites a passionate romance, which unfolds against the backdrop of Turpin’s life as a notorious bandit.

As Turpin races across the countryside, covering over 200 miles on horseback, he becomes embroiled in a whirlwind of adventure that involves evading capture, daring robberies, and championing the cause of the downtrodden. The mischief and excitement come to a head as Turpin must navigate both his growing affection for Lady Bess and the perilous lifestyle that defines him.

Cast

  • Louis Hayward as Dick Turpin
  • Patricia Medina as Lady Bess
  • Suzanne Dalbert as Camilla
